3 Killed, One Injured In Fresh Plateau Attack After Tinubu’s Visit 

Three people have lost their lives and one person sustained injuries following a violent attack in Nyamgo Gyel, located in Jos South Local Government Area of Plateau State. The incident happened on Friday evening when a group of youths was returning home from a mining site in Gero.

According to reports, the victims were riding on motorbikes around 7 p.m. when armed men suddenly opened fire on them. The attack caused panic, forcing others in the group, said to be about 15 people, to scatter in different directions to escape.

The deceased were identified as Luka Pam, Samuel Davou, and Deme Saidu. Community members described the incident as shocking and heartbreaking, especially as the victims were reportedly returning after observing Good Friday activities earlier in the day.

Local youth leaders expressed concern over the repeated nature of attacks in the area and called on security agencies to take urgent action. They also mentioned that suspicious movements had previously been reported around nearby locations, urging residents to remain alert while authorities step up surveillance.

Following the attack, only the police were said to have responded, evacuating the injured victim to a hospital. The incident has further heightened tension in the community, coming shortly after recent engagements between national leadership and affected families in Plateau State, where assurances were given that such violence would be prevented in the future.
